summaryrefslogtreecommitdiffstats
path: root/abs/extra-testing/community/mythpywii/PKGBUILD
blob: 38e456f282cee6e2c4ea142cd209c676ad8102c7 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
# $Id: PKGBUILD 5936 2008-07-21 20:24:16Z thomas $
# Maintainer: Cecil Watson<knoppmyth@gmail.com>

pkgname=mythpywii
pkgver=17
pkgrel=8
pkgdesc="Control MythTV using Wiimote."
arch=('i686' 'x86_64')
license=('GPL2')
url="http://www.benjiegillam.com/"
depends=('bluez' 'python-pybluez' 'cwiid-svn')
install=mythpywii.install
source=(http://www.benjiegillam.com/code/myth_py_wii.py \
        wiimote.rules mythpywii.install CONTROLS)

build() {
  install -D -m755 ${srcdir}/myth_py_wii.py ${startdir}/pkg/usr/bin/myth_py_wii.py || return 1
  install -D -m644 ${srcdir}/wiimote.rules ${startdir}/pkg/etc/udev/rules.d/z90-wiimote.rules || return 1
  install -d -o mythtv -g mythtv ${startdir}/pkg/home/mythtv/.cwiid/wminput || return 1
  install -D -m755 -o mythtv -g mythtv /etc/cwiid/wminput/{acc_led,buttons,gamepad,neverball,nunchuk_stick2btn,acc_ptr,ir_ptr,nunchuk_acc_ptr} ${startdir}/pkg/home/mythtv/.cwiid/wminput || return 1
  install -D -m644 ${srcdir}/CONTROLS ${startdir}/pkg/usr/share/docs/mythpywii/CONTROLS || return 1
  cd ${startdir}/pkg/home/mythtv/.cwiid/wminput
  ln -s acc_led default
}
md5sums=('5bd5e1bb9c4cbfabbffdb28ff616e83b'
         '0d817a971d414b9320587a4cf289386b'
         '64fa8dbd324dac68f71753ebd828d358'
         '0872cbdb3def3dd9aa2b97b191ad76d8')